Medium to deep ruby-purple colored, the 2016 Pinot Noir Finn bursts forth with vivacious notions of red cherries, pomegranate and rhubarb plus nuances of violets, dried herbs, underbrush, mossy bark and black tea. Medium-bodied, the palate is firmly textured with ripe grainy tannins and possesses lovely freshness, which coaxes the elegant earthy flavors to a nice, long finish.
